Introduce “Dynamic Member” fulfillment of Protocols
|
|
16
|
5233
|
February 9, 2024
|
[Macros] Accessing the "parent context" of a syntax node passed to a macro
|
|
23
|
4287
|
February 3, 2024
|
Allow coercion of `Optional<T>` to `Optional<UnsafePointer<T>>`
|
|
0
|
313
|
February 2, 2024
|
Array constructor from Mirror Subject?
|
|
2
|
408
|
February 2, 2024
|
Special syntax for blocks that capture all variables as weak
|
|
18
|
2895
|
February 1, 2024
|
Retain overflow checks when compiled with `-Ounchecked`
|
|
67
|
3041
|
January 26, 2024
|
Change of how FloatingPointLiteral is Handled by the Compiler
|
|
24
|
1787
|
January 25, 2024
|
[Pitch] Non-Frozen Enumerations
|
|
73
|
3445
|
January 23, 2024
|
[Pitch] Default values for string interpolations
|
|
57
|
3416
|
January 23, 2024
|
[Pitch] Expression macro as caller-side default argument
|
|
5
|
1563
|
January 23, 2024
|
[Pitch] Inheriting the caller's actor isolation
|
|
17
|
2709
|
January 22, 2024
|
[Pitch] Low-level operations for volatile memory accesses
|
|
21
|
2637
|
January 20, 2024
|
[Pitch] Typed throws in the Concurrency module
|
|
33
|
3724
|
January 16, 2024
|
[Pitch] Generalize `AsyncSequence` and `AsyncIteratorProtocol`
|
|
18
|
2067
|
January 11, 2024
|
Multiple Types
|
|
77
|
5044
|
January 8, 2024
|
Async await and Result type
|
|
1
|
796
|
January 6, 2024
|
Accepting SwiftPM binary target dependencies
|
|
17
|
3878
|
January 3, 2024
|
[Pitch] Region Based Isolation
|
|
14
|
4993
|
December 26, 2023
|
Pitch: Resolve Objective-C Forward Declarations to @objc Swift Definitions
|
|
8
|
2797
|
December 26, 2023
|
[Pitch] Protocol Macros
|
|
20
|
2931
|
December 8, 2023
|
[Pitch] Unsafe Assume on MainActor
|
|
21
|
4028
|
December 15, 2023
|
Creating lenses with Swift macros (usecase for arbitrary names at the global scope)
|
|
86
|
2549
|
December 15, 2023
|
Task {} syntax sugar
|
|
29
|
1873
|
December 11, 2023
|
Pitch: Debug Description macro
|
|
12
|
2001
|
December 8, 2023
|
[Pitch #3] Async Let
|
|
70
|
5343
|
December 7, 2023
|
[Pitch] Sequence grouped(by:) and keyed(by:)
|
|
20
|
3597
|
December 5, 2023
|
[Pitch] Consistently prohibiting classes with missing required initializers
|
|
9
|
1194
|
December 5, 2023
|
New keyword for method
|
|
2
|
711
|
November 30, 2023
|
Allow trailing commas in parameter lists
|
|
40
|
2133
|
November 29, 2023
|
[Pitch Revision #4] Add Collection Operations on Noncontiguous Elements
|
|
5
|
1969
|
November 27, 2023
|